I had sent two direct requests with IRCs to Bob's address in Pakistan
without receiving a response. I met Bob again on 17M and asked him
about the QSLs. He gave me his email address and below is part of his
answer. Contrary to a previous posting, Bob advises the use IRCs.
Bob at one time had a stateside QSL manager. I still wonder why he
wants direct with all of his postal problems.
"Thanks for Msg. Pleasure meeting U again! On checking LOG, found U
but it seems I had NOT received ur QSLs sent with IRCs!
I have had trouble with QSLs sent with $ as such QSLs are intercepted
by Postal Thieves who not only pocket the enclosed $ but also destroy
the QSL-Card & as I am NOT aware of the Theft (& do NOT receive the Card),
I am not in position to send Return-QSL!! I always advise Hams to send
only IRCs for this reason! Usually, QSLs with IRC reach us intact as IRCs
are NOT of use to the Thieves who could be caught while exchanging IRCs
at Main Post Office only!! Anyway, as U had already sent QSLs with IRCs
(which I did NOT receive), I am sending U QSLs direct via Address given
in qrz.com!! Please send Msg whenever U receive QSLs!!"
Best wishes, Bob.(AP2JZB).
